Pteroclididae Sandgrouse have small, pigeon-like heads and necks and sturdy compact bodies. They range in size from 24 to 40 centimetres 9.4 to 15.7 in in length and from 150 to 500 grams 5.3 to 17.6 oz in weight. The adults are sexually dimorphic with the males being slightly larger and more brightly colored than the females.
